    Seems like every time I work on drop targets on a Williams solid state game the screw holes for the screws that hold the little pc boards in place are stripped. Usually I just use Loctite on the screws and hope for the best, or maybe try a slightly larger sheet metal screw. Since the plastic drop target guides are unavailable that's the best I could come up with. I had to re-think that approach with an Alien Poker that I'm working on. The screw holes weren't stripped, they were mostly completely missing, the plastic studs were broken off. I removed the drop target guides, drilled through them, and inserted 5-40 screws from the back. Used plastic sleeves as spacers, then 5-40 nuts to hold the pc boards in place. So far everything is working.
